M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
articulates
issues
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
evolvements in
elearning technology are providing the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to take classes online.
These MOOCs are
mostly free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
elearning technology organizations
have to deal with
in 2015 because online learning technology is
developing so rapidly.
How can participants
certify that
the quality of schooling provided by these
MOOC classes is
respectable?
How can institutions
make sure that
instructors are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online MOOC classes?
What different business models are being used by
institutions like
Udemy to conduct these MOOCs?
What assessment strategies and teaching practices are in use today?
How can teachers
get a handle on
low
motivation and high
student dropout rates?
